Install of PackStack on Centos Stream 9
See attachment


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
openstack-rdo-antelope
openstack-rdo-zen
openstack-rdo-yoga

How reproducible:
Do a standard install on Packstack, cinder LVM on Centos 9 

Steps to Reproduce:
Do a standard install on Packstack, cinder LVM on Centos 9 
Add an Centos8 stream image
Boot image from volume
Create empty volume and attach (this bit goes fine) 
Try to detach either via UI or CLI and Cinder complains that the volume is in use by nova when nova has detached the volume (message in logs) 

Actual results:
Cinder volume remains "detaching", VM no longer has volume attached


Expected results:
Cinder volume detaches and ends up "available" and not attached


Additional info:
logs attached from Nova and Cinder


I mostly use OpenStack to run persistent workloads in Kubernetes, this makes it nearly unuseable as cinder-csi removes and attaches volumes on diffrent VMs as part of normal lifedycle

Comment 1 jon.hartley@btinternet.com 2023-08-03 07:14:19 UTC
This happens EVERY time I try to detach a volume, have tried all RDO releases for Centos9 Stream 
All other functionality seems fine, create VMs. networks, routers etc etc
Can run up a 5 node rancher k8s cluster but as soon as it comes to moving PV attachments around pods get stuck in Pending as the CSI cant mount the PV on the new node
